Financial investment management companies assist their customers, who are normally large organizations and individuals with lots of money and/or important ownerships (properties), increase their fortune. They do this by merging and investing their clients' wealth keeping in mind the level of danger that clients desire to take and their financial objectives.

Investment management firms can also be known as asset management companies or cash management firms - Which of these is the best description of personal finance. Jobs in financial investment management can be discovered at investment management companies, such as M&G Investments and Fidelity International, insurance companies, such as Allianz and AXA, and large banks, such as Barclays and HSBC. There are several elements to investment management consisting of managing and investing funds, researching companies, and keeping and developing IT systems to support clients and staff so a financial investment management company will make up numerous divisions in which different people with various skills will work. There are 2 primary sides to banking: retail and investment.

Some banks specialise in just among these locations while others cover more than one. Retail banking supplies a series of financial products to specific customers, such as home mortgages, personal loans, charge card, debit cards and cost savings accounts. Organizations, such as newsagents, will also need direct access to comparable services and products; this is understood as business (or business) banking. Investment banking includes advising cash/asset-rich people and organizations on raising money for business endeavors and service technique, such as mergers (two business merging to create a brand-new business) and acquisitions (one company buying another). Investment banks also use their own and their customers' cash in trade deals to generate income.

Financial investment banks also have numerous parts, so job opportunity will cover various departments. There are two main functions within insurance coverage: underwriting and investment. Underwriting involves measuring customers' direct exposure to the danger that they wish to be insured versus (eg if they desire home insurance, that would be the likelihood of their house being burglarized or flooded) and choosing just how much money to charge to insure (or finance) that threat.

Types of insurance coverage vary; there's general, life, health and industrial, for example, and customers consist of individuals http://dominickcnym983.trexgame.net/rumored-buzz-on-how-much-do-finance-managers-make-at-car-dealerships and organisations both big and small. In addition to underwriting and financial investment, functions in insurance period other locations, consisting of compliance (understanding and adhering to guidelines) and marketing (establishing and issuing information). Actuarial science using mathematics, data, and understanding of business and economics to assess the likelihood of something bad happening is closely linked to insurance coverage. It is often a function within insurance companies or it can be carried out by expert actuarial firms whose customers consist of insurer. There are five significant types of employer within the insurance coverage market: insurance coverage companies; retail banks and particular sellers, such as supermarkets; insurance coverage brokers; the Lloyd's of London insurance market where brokers fulfill underwriters; and professional consultancies that supply expert suggestions in a specific area.
